Role Overview

Fermi America is seeking a Senior Data Center Technical Manager to serve as the technical authority for all data center engineering and infrastructure systems across Fermi's hyperscale program. This role owns the full spectrum of technical engineering within the DC space-electrical, mechanical, controls, fire protection, and building management systems-ensuring that design standards, equipment specifications, and vendor commitments produce constructable, maintainable, and reliable infrastructure.


The DC Sr Technical Manager will serve as Fermi's design liaison, bridging the gap between Fermi's technical standards and external design consultants, integrators, and engineering partners. This role reviews design deliverables for conformance with Fermi's basis of design, drives technical standardization across all building packages, and ensures that engineering decisions translate into field-ready solutions. When the tenant encounters design or engineering challenges, this role leads the technical resolution while upholding and protecting Fermi's design integrity.


The DC Sr Technical Manager will lead a team of discipline-specific subject matter experts-electrical, mechanical, and controls-providing technical governance across all data center packages. This role also owns vendor management strategy for critical data center equipment, ensuring technical specifications and vendor capacity commitments are aligned with construction delivery schedules and customer requirements.


This role reports directly to the Head of DC Service & Delivery and works closely with procurement, design integration, preconstruction, construction, safety, quality, and project controls functions. This is a matrix environment where success depends on influence and partnership as much as direct authority. The right leader builds strong, collaborative relationships across every function and fosters a culture of transparency, shared accountability, and mutual respect.


Key Responsibilities

Serve as Fermi's technical authority across all data center MEP disciplines-electrical distribution, mechanical cooling, controls and automation, fire protection, and building management systems-ensuring design and construction decisions meet Fermi's performance, reliability, and redundancy standards


Act as the design liaison between Fermi and external design consultants, integrators, and engineering firms-reviewing design deliverables for conformance with Fermi's basis of design (BOD), technical standards, and applicable industry codes (Uptime Institute, ASHRAE, NFPA, NETA, TIA-942)


Own and maintain Fermi's data center basis of design and technical standards documentation, driving consistency across all building packages and ensuring standards evolve as the program scales and technology advances


Interface with the tenant's technical representatives on design and engineering challenges-providing technical support, evaluating proposed modifications for impact on facility systems, and ensuring resolutions uphold Fermi's design integrity and do not compromise redundancy, reliability, or other tenants' infrastructure


Own the technical specification and vendor qualification process for all critical data center equipment-including medium-voltage switchgear, UPS systems, PDUs, generators, cooling distribution units, chillers, and building management systems


Lead and mentor a team of DC subject matter experts (Electrical SME, Mechanical SME, Controls SME) to provide technical oversight across all active and upcoming building packages


Establish and maintain vendor capacity tracking systems, monitoring supplier production schedules, factory acceptance testing, and delivery commitments


Drive technical standardization across the data center program-defining preferred equipment platforms, approved vendor lists, and standard specification packages to reduce design variability and accelerate procurement


Partner with the QA/QC Commissioning Manager on commissioning and technical readiness-providing technical input on performance goals, redundancy validation protocols, and testing sequences to ensure every building is energized safely and meets design intent prior to tenant load


Serve as the technical escalation point for equipment-related RFIs, substitution requests, design conflicts, and field issues during construction and commissioning


Partner with procurement to negotiate technical terms, evaluate vendor proposals, and conduct factory visits and production readiness assessments


Coordinate with the Sr DC Design Integration Manager to ensure equipment specifications are properly reflected in design documents and that vendor data is incorporated into construction-ready packages


Track industry trends in data center technology-including high-density cooling, liquid cooling architectures, advanced power distribution, and energy storage-to inform Fermi's technical roadmap and design standards evolution


Build and sustain a strong, collaborative culture across the technical management function-fostering open communication, mutual accountability, and trust with procurement, construction, design, and project controls partners

Requirements

Relevant Experience

15+ years of experience in data center engineering, technical program management, or critical infrastructure delivery, with at least 8 years in hyperscale or mission-critical environments


Deep technical knowledge across all data center MEP disciplines-including critical power distribution architectures (2N, N+1, catcher), cooling system design (air-cooled, liquid-cooled, hybrid), fire protection, controls and automation, and building management systems


Demonstrated experience serving as a technical authority or design liaison on multi-billion-dollar data center or mission-critical infrastructure programs, with direct responsibility for reviewing and approving design deliverables against owner standards


Strong understanding of data center basis of design (BOD) development, technical standards governance, and the translation of customer technical requirements into constructable specifications


Experience managing vendor relationships and critical equipment procurement, including specification development, factory acceptance testing (FAT), and commissioning oversight


Track record of leading technical teams (engineers, SMEs) across multiple concurrent projects or building phases


Demonstrated experience interfacing with tenant technical representatives to resolve design and engineering challenges while maintaining design integrity and facility reliability


Experience partnering with commissioning teams on hyperscale or mission-critical facilities, including technical input on performance testing, redundancy validation, and integrated systems testing


Excellent communication skills with the ability to translate complex technical concepts for commercial, construction, and executive stakeholders. Proven ability to operate effectively in a matrix organization where influence, alignment, and partnership are as important as direct authority


Bachelor's degree in Electrical Engineering, Mechanical Engineering, or related technical discipline; advanced degree preferred


Preferred Qualifications

Direct experience with hyperscale data center programs for major technology companies (e.g., Google, Meta, Microsoft, AWS, Oracle) or leading data center developers (Equinix, Digital Realty, QTS, Compass, EdgeCore)


Professional Engineer (PE) licensure in Electrical or Mechanical Engineering


BICSI Data Center Design Consultant (DCDC) certification or equivalent design standards expertise


Familiarity with emerging data center technologies including liquid cooling (direct-to-chip, rear-door heat exchangers), high-density power distribution, and advanced BMS/EPMS platforms


Experience with Uptime Institute Tier III/IV certification processes and concurrent maintainability requirements


Working knowledge of NETA acceptance testing standards, arc flash analysis, and critical power commissioning sequences
